the doctor orders drug a for a 145lb patient. the dose of drug x is 2.5mg/kg every 12 h. the supply of drug x is 0.80mg/ml. how many ml of drug a need to be given per dose?

Answer :

The solution is 206 ml, rounded to three significant numbers. As a result, each dosage requires 206 ml of medication A.

As per the question given,

First, we need to find the weight of the patient in kilograms. We know that 1 kg is equal to 2.20462 lbs, so:

145 lbs ÷ 2.20462 lbs/kg = 65.77 kg

Next, we can calculate the dose of drug A:

2.5 mg/kg × 65.77 kg = 164.43 mg

Finally, we can find how many ml of drug A need to be given per dose by dividing the dose by the supply concentration:

164.43 mg ÷ 0.80 mg/ml ≈ 205.54 ml

Rounding to three significant figures, the answer is 206 ml. Therefore, 206 ml of drug A need to be given per dose.
